What Is a Hydrocele?

A hydrocele occurs when fluid collects in the thin sac surrounding the testicle. It may develop in newborns or adult men. In adults, it can result from injury, infection, or inflammation.

Hydrocele is generally not dangerous, but persistent swelling should always be evaluated by a specialist.


Symptoms of Hydrocele

  • Painless swelling in one or both testicles

  • Feeling of heaviness in the scrotum

  • Discomfort while walking or sitting

  • Gradual increase in scrotal size

If the swelling becomes painful or sudden, immediate medical consultation is necessary.


Causes of Hydrocele

  • Injury to the scrotum

  • Infection or inflammation

  • Post-surgical complications

  • Congenital conditions (in infants)


Hydrocele Treatment Options

The choice of treatment depends on the severity and underlying cause.

1. Observation

Small and painless hydroceles may not require immediate treatment. Regular monitoring may be advised.

2. Medication

If caused by infection or inflammation, appropriate medications may help manage the condition.

3. Hydrocelectomy (Surgical Treatment)

Surgery is the most effective and permanent solution for hydrocele. The procedure involves removing the fluid-filled sac to prevent recurrence.

Benefits of surgical treatment include:

  • Permanent relief

  • Minimal recurrence

  • Short hospital stay

  • Quick recovery

The procedure is generally safe and performed under anesthesia.

Recovery After Hydrocele Surgery

Most patients can return to normal activities within a few days to a week. Complete healing typically occurs within a few weeks. Following post-operative instructions ensures smooth recovery.
